A Rare Turquoise-Ground Famille Rose Yangcai Vase, Daoguang Mark

清道光款 松石綠地 洋彩纏枝蓮鳳銜靈芝圖瓶

Finely enamelled on the globular body with four large Indian lotus blooms, turquoise glaze throughout both the exterior and interior, the flared mouth rim similarly decorated with a blue enamelled ‘hui’ diaper band, further decorated with a band of classic ruyi, supported on a slightly splayed foot
height 13.2" — 33.6 cm.
underglazed six-character Daoguang mark to base

Estimate $6,000-$8,000

Realised: $8,125

Provenance:

From an important estate, New Orleans
Private Toronto Collection

Note:

A comparable vase in "Porcelains with Cloisonné Enamel Decoration and Famille Rose Decoration: The Complete Collection of Treasures of the Palace Museum Collection", Hong Kong, 1999, vol. 39, p. 216, no. 191. Similar examples are also in the collection of the National Palace Museum, Taipei and the Shanghai Museum. For a similar design from the Daoguang period, see Christie’s Hong Kong, June 1, 2011, lot 4016
